Rafael Furlanetti joins the board of Abrasca

XP executive and president of Ancord joins the body of the association that represents public companies

announced, on Monday (May 25, 2026), the entry of Rafael Furlanetti on your advice. The executive is managing partner of XP Investimentos and president of. Here is the Abrasca Board of Directors (PDF – 168 kB).

Abrasca represents Brazilian public companies and works on issues related to the capital markets, corporate governance and business environment.

According to the association, Furlanetti’s inclusion seeks to expand the diversity of perspectives within the board and reinforce the presence of leaders with experience in the financial, business and institutional sectors.

Furlanetti joins other executives from the Brazilian business sector who already make up the board. Among them are Rodrigo Moccia, from Ambev, and Luiz Guimarães, ex-Cosan. The association’s board of directors is chaired by Renato Alves Vale, from Vale SA, who assumes the role of president. The vice-presidency is held by Rodrigo Boccia Pfeilsticker, from Ambev, while the executive board is headed by Veridiana Carvalho Amaral.

The executive will serve on the board alongside the other advisors. He will contribute to the entity’s decisions related to the development of the capital market, corporate governance and business environment in Brazil. The full composition of the board of directors also includes representatives from companies such as Petrobras, Itaú Unibanco, Bradesco, Banco do Brasil, Santander Brasil, BTG Pactual, Eletrobras, Gerdau, Klabin, Localiza, Magazine Luiza, Rede D’Or, Suzano and WEG, among other publicly traded companies.

Furlanetti will participate in discussions related to the development of the Brazilian capital market and initiatives to strengthen corporate governance.
